I hear you but 32 or 33 is not THAT big of a difference. You already already passed 30 :-)

I think you have to compartmentalize at the moment. That’s what I am doing at least to focus on the immediate needs and fears, frankly. However if you are going for a 2-year MBA program, I think the opportunities for jobs and internships will be there. It may require a late start or first quarter to be online but with a number of companies canceling internships for this year, opportunities may abound the year after. Anyone has other thoughts?

PS. Perhaps the visa interviews can be remote or via Skype, least for the student visas?
